  • Abstract
    This paper presents the investigation of harmonic currents of a power system associated with a static Var compensator for grid-connected induction generators under condition of low wind speed. The static Var compensator uses fixed capacitor and thyristor controlled reactor. The investigation of reactive power compensation for 2.2 kW, 220/380 V, 8.5/5.2A, Δ/Y, 4 P, induction generator has been performed under low wind speed and constant power factor at 0.9. The obtained results can be guidelines for harmonic mitigation of reactive power compensation for grid-connected induction generators inside a nation.
